Amq-command — различия между версиями

Материал из ANT-Inform documentation
Перейти к: навигация, поиск
(Create amq-command)
 
м (Склонения)
 
(не показана одна промежуточная версия этого же участника)
Строка 6: Строка 6:
  
 
1 аргумент обязательный, второй - нет:
 
1 аргумент обязательный, второй - нет:
; 1 аргумент : посылаемая команда. Если меет пробелы и/или спецсимволы, должны быть соответствующим образом экранирована, и/или взята в кавычки
+
; 1 аргумент : посылаемая команда. Если меет пробелы и/или спецсимволы, должен быть соответствующим образом экранирован, и/или взят в кавычки
 
; 2 аргумент : очередь в которую посылать. По умолчанию AIS.CMDCONF.IN
 
; 2 аргумент : очередь в которую посылать. По умолчанию AIS.CMDCONF.IN
  
 
{{ ambox || text = '''Пример''': amq-command Region }}
 
{{ ambox || text = '''Пример''': amq-command Region }}
 +
 +
{{ ambox || text = Для запуска полной синхронизации двух систем, как она происходит ночью по умолчанию, вы можете посмотреть список выполняемых [[Команды адаптера|команд]] в файле ais.properties в опциях '''import.task[1-5].name''' }}

Текущая версия на 10:57, 7 мая 2013

При повторе отправки команд, или попытке автоматизировать данный процесс, становится удобным использовать консольный инструмент.

Предлагается простой инструмент (работает через очередь ActiveMQ) - консольная утилитка amq-command.

В общем случае, позволяет отправить любую команду, в любую очередь.

1 аргумент обязательный, второй - нет:

1 аргумент 
посылаемая команда. Если меет пробелы и/или спецсимволы, должен быть соответствующим образом экранирован, и/или взят в кавычки
2 аргумент 
очередь в которую посылать. По умолчанию AIS.CMDCONF.IN